How to Make German Chocolate Cheese Pie

  1. Preheat oven to 300°F (150°C).
  2. Grease a 9-inch pie plate.
  3. In a medium bowl, combine 1 ½ cups crushed corn flakes, ¼ cup packed brown sugar, and 6 tablespoons (3 ounces) melted butter. Mix until evenly moistened.
  4.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of the prepared pie plate. Bake for 10 minutes.
  5. Remove from oven and let cool completely.
  6. While the crust cools, prepare the filling. In a medium saucepan, combine 1 cup water and 6 ounces semi-sweet chocolate chips over low heat. Stir constantly until the chocolate is melted and smooth.
  7. Remove from heat and let cool for 10 minutes.
  8. In a large bowl, beat together 8 ounces cream cheese (softened), ½ cup packed brown sugar, 1 teaspoon v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t until smooth and creamy.
  9. Gradually add the cooled melted chocolate to the cream cheese mixture, mixing until well combined.
  10. Ref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or until the filling has thickened considerably.
  11. In a separate bowl, whip 1 cup heavy cream until stiff peaks form.
  12. Gently fold the whipped cream into the chocolate cream cheese mixture.
  13. Pour the filling into the cooled crust.
  14. Freeze for at least 4 hours, or preferably overnight, before serving.
